BioShock received widespread acclaim from critics, many of whom have praised the game for its engaging storyline, immersive sound design and deep combat system.Gaming Nexus: BioShock awards starting to roll in (November 5, 2007)IGN: BioShock Review
The PC version, in particular, has been the target of much criticism over its use of SecuROM, which limited the amount of times a person could activate the game. In order to restore an activation credit, owners were required to uninstall a previous copy and contact SecuROM.GamesRadar: 2K responds to PC BioShock complaints (August 24, 2007) After receiving numerous complaints, 2K Games eventually revoked the measure, allowing users to install the game as many times as they wanted. However, activating the game and keeping the disc in the drive is still mandatory.Shacknews: BioShock PC Install Limit Lifted, DRM Remains (June 20, 2008)
